Define herbs
They are the leaves, stems and roots of plants used to flavour foods. When chopped or heated they release aromatic oils which flavour food.
Define spices
They are dried flowers, seeds, leaves, bark, roots or aromatic plant that can be bought whole or powdered. Ground with a pestle and mortar.
Explain how to prepare and cook broccoli in order to preserve the vit C context.
If boiling, put straight into boiling water and then, when al dente, plunge in cold water to prevent further loss of nutrients.
To prevent it you could steam the broccoli instead.
